Je viens de recevoir un nouvel ordinateur portable avec Microsoft Windows 10. Mon ordinateur portable précédent fonctionnait sous Windows 7.
J'essaie de faire en sorte que les applications soient "exécutées en tant qu'administrateur" par défaut, de sorte que je n'ai pas constamment de problèmes à enregistrer/écraser des fichiers, etc. La priorité ici est de pouvoir modifier mes propres fichiers sur un disque dur externe; Je n'aurais pas pensé que je devrais faire quelque chose de spécial pour pouvoir faire cela. Mon compte d'utilisateur sur l'ordinateur portable est un compte "Administrateur" et j'ai défini le paramètre Contrôle de compte d'utilisateur sur "Ne jamais notifier". Je pensais que cela produirait l'effet que je souhaitais (comme suggéré également dans cette question connexe en relation avec Windows 7).
Voici une capture d'écran de ma configuration pour désactiver le contrôle de compte d'utilisateur dans Windows 10:
Pourtant, Notepad ++ (par exemple) ne commence pas automatiquement avec les droits administratifs. Que dois-je faire d'autre ou qu'est-ce que je néglige?
Merci
PS Je suis conscient que ce que j'essaie de faire est un risque pour la sécurité, mais ce n'est pas le but de cette question; si je dois ou non faire quelque chose est différent de savoir si je peux ou ne peux pas faire quelque chose.
Réponse mise à jour: résoudre le problème au lieu de répondre à la question.
Pour modifier les listes de contrôle d'accès sur le lecteur externe, ouvrez ses propriétés et accédez à l'onglet Sécurité:
Notez que les utilisateurs authentifiés ne disposent pas du "contrôle total"; seuls les administrateurs le font, et vous n'êtes pas vraiment membre des administrateurs à moins d'être élevé. Cliquez sur Advanced.
(Le propriétaire sera probablement des administrateurs.) Cliquez sur Ajouter.
Cliquez sur "Sélectionnez un principal" et tapez votre nom d'utilisateur dans la case. Cochez "Contrôle total", puis cliquez sur OK.
Maintenant que nous sommes de retour dans l'éditeur ACL avancé, cochez la case qui remplace les ACL des éléments enfants. Cliquez sur OK et acceptez l'avertissement. Cliquez sur OK dans la fenêtre des propriétés, attendez que l'opération soit terminée (le cas échéant) et vous avez terminé.
_ {La réponse originale (dangereuse) suit en dessous de la ligne.} _
Danger! C'est presque certainement un mauvais plan, pour des raisons expliquées dans le commentaire de Ramhound.
Exécutez gpedit.msc
pour ouvrir l'éditeur de stratégie de groupe local. Développez Configuration de l'ordinateur, Paramètres Windows, Paramètres de sécurité, Stratégies locales et Options de sécurité. Quatre paramètres doivent être mis à jour:
Le LGPE enregistre automatiquement toutes les modifications, quittez-le et redémarrez.
Encore une fois, c'est une configuration très peu sécurisée que vous créez ici.
Il semble qu'il existe quelques options pour exécuter une application en tant qu'administrateur par défaut que vous pouvez essayer.
Remarque: lors de l'essai de ma deuxième option (ci-dessus), une application ne contenait pas initialement la case "Exécuter ce programme en tant qu'administrateur". Je devais faire ce qui suit pour que la case à cocher apparaisse et toujours s'exécuter en tant qu'administrateur:
Bill Garrison a confirmé que la solution trouvée dans Comment exécuter TOUTES mes applications «en tant qu’administrateur» par défaut dans Windows 7? fonctionne pour Windows 10. Il existe au moins une autre méthode. Vous pouvez définir le paramètre de contrôle de compte d'utilisateur le plus bas, mais cela provoque également l'échec des applications natives de Windows 10 (telles que la calculatrice).
Vous trouverez ci-dessous la réponse réponse :
Ajouter un utilisateur au groupe d'administrateurs et supprimer du groupe d'utilisateurs:
Connectez-vous en tant qu'administrateur
Aller à courir (WinKey + R)
Tapez "control userpasswords2"
Sélectionnez votre compte et cliquez sur "Propriétés"
Sélectionnez l'onglet "Appartenance à un groupe"
Sélectionnez "Administrateurs"
Cliquez sur OK et sur OK
Désactiver le mode d'approbation
Connectez-vous en tant qu'administrateur
Aller à courir (WinKey + R)
Tapez "secpol.msc"
Aller à la police locale> Options de sécurité
Trouver "Contrôle de compte d'utilisateur: Basculez vers le bureau sécurisé lorsque vous demandez une élévation"
Ouvrez-le Cliquez sur le désactiver et cliquez sur OK.
Redémarrer l'ordinateur (la fermeture de session très importante ne fonctionne pas)
Pour désactiver complètement le contrôle de compte d'utilisateur, la propriété EnableLUA
de
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Policies\System
dans le registre doit être changé en 0
. Cela désactive le type d'utilisateur "administrateur en mode d'approbation administrateur", permettant ainsi à tous les utilisateurs administrateurs d'exécuter leurs processus en tant qu'administrateur par défaut.
Voir aussi: EnableLUA | msdn.Microsoft.com
Après cela, vos programmes/processus seront exécutés en mode Administrateur par défaut (étant donné que votre utilisateur est un administrateur), c’est-à-dire que vous ne rencontrerez pas (beaucoup) de difficultés pour enregistrer des fichiers dans certains emplacements, sans lancer le programme respectif uniquement Administrateur d'abord.
(depuis Toujours exécuter les programmes en tant qu'administrateur dans Windows 10 | Super utilisateur )
// ah désolé, ceci est un duplicata de la réponse originale de @ ben-n - seule la différence le fait via le registre au lieu de gpedit.msc
Si une recherche vous mène ici et que vous souhaitez toujours exécuter une application spécifique en tant qu'administrateur, même lors du lancement du type de fichier associé, vous devez utiliser le registre. Ces onglets de compatibilité sur les propriétés ne sont plus disponibles dans Windows 10.
Pour pourquoi vous devriez ou ne devriez pas faire cela, vous devez regarder ailleurs.
Ci-dessous, vous apprendrez comment.
Créez une nouvelle clé de registre dans l'une de ces clés existantes: (créez également la clé "Layers" - si nécessaire)
(for current account only)
HKEY_CURRENT_USER\Software\Microsoft\Windows NT\CurrentVersion\AppCompatFlags\Layers
(for all users)
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T\CurrentVersion\AppCompatFlags\Layers
Le nom de la nouvelle clé doit correspondre au chemin (sans guillemets) de l'application que vous souhaitez toujours lancer avec privilèges.
Par exemple:
"C:\Program Files (x86)\Microsoft Visual Studio\2017\Professional\Common7\IDE\devenv.exe"
(but WITHOUT quotes!)
La valeur de cette clé doit être
~ RUNASADMIN
Une fois que vous avez correctement défini la valeur et le nom de la clé, vous avez terminé! Lancez l'application à l'aide d'un fichier associé et vous verrez l'invite d'élévation.
Il suffit de lancer Powershell en tant qu'administrateur, puis entrez ceci:
Set-ItemProperty -Path "HKLM:\SOFTWARE\Microsoft\Windows\CurrentVersion\Policies\System" -Name "EnableLUA" -Value "0"
shutdown -r -t 0